[0025] The present invention will be further described below in conjunction with specific examples.

[0026] Such as figure 1 As shown, the outer wall of the novel peristaltic pump is a glass pipe 5, one end of which is sealed with a pump cover 2, and the other end is open. The artificial muscle expansion element 4 is composed of rubber tubes with excellent expansion and sealing properties, and the rubber tubes are connected by flanges 3 . The artificial muscle expansion element 4 is built in the glass tube 5, and there is a gap around it. Abstract

The invention relates to a regulating and control method based on a novel peristaltic pump. The peristaltic pump adopts pneumatic artificial muscles as an actuator and comprises a pump cover assembly,artificial muscle expansion components, flanges and air pipelines. A regulated and controlled control system comprises an air compressor, an air storage bottle, a motion control card, a relay module,a proportional pressure-regulating valve, two-position two-way reversing valves and a pressure sensor. Modules of the control system are connected from the air compressor, the air storage bottle, theproportional pressure-regulating valve, the two-position two-way reversing valves and the artificial muscle expansion components to a mechanical mechanism. During regulating and control, the output air pressure of the air compressor, the air pressure of the air storage bottle, the air pressure of a control loop, the working air pressure of the proportional pressure-regulating valve and the working air pressure of the pneumatic artificial muscles are verified sequentially, and the detection results are fed back. The peristaltic pump can transport a fluid medium and is provided with a self-insurance mechanism, and thus a pump body is not damaged during long-time working; the space occupied by the peristaltic pump is saved, and outdoor using is facilitated; the control system is stable and orderly; and the peristaltic pump works with the optimal efficiency, and the production efficiency is improved.

Description

technical field [0001] The invention relates to the fields of transportation using compressed air as a power source, and in particular to a control method based on a novel peristaltic pump. Background technique [0002] Peristaltic pump is a new type of fluid delivery pump after rotor pump, centrifugal pump, diaphragm pump, etc. It is being widely promoted and applied in various industries such as medical treatment, medicine, food, beverage, chemical industry, and smelting. [0003] At present, peristaltic pumps capable of transmitting fluids are required by many industries, such as factory transportation systems, field and emergency situations. Usually these fluids are transported by positive displacement pumps and vane pumps. However, the fluid easily collides with the impeller of the vane pump and damages the pump.
